True Solar Time in BaZi: Why Your Birthplace and Clock Time Can Matter

Many BaZi calculators ask for a birthplace for more than a time-zone lookup. Traditional chart calculation may compare civil clock time with local solar time. The difference can come from longitude within a time zone, daylight-saving time in historical records, and the equation of time.

This matters most near a traditional two-hour boundary. If a correction moves a recorded time from one branch to another, the hour pillar can change. Away from a boundary, the same correction may not alter the pillar at all. A transparent calculator should show whether a correction changed the date or hour branch rather than implying that every result is equally sensitive.

There is no single universal BaZi convention. Some practitioners use standard local time; some apply true solar-time adjustments; some make different choices around the Zi-hour day boundary. These differences are a reason for humility, not alarm. If you compare charts across websites, compare their calculation policies before deciding that one result is “wrong.”

For the best input, use the birthplace named on the record, the local clock time recorded at birth, and the correct historical date. Do not convert it to UTC yourself unless a particular tool asks you to. If a family only remembers “around noon” or “late evening,” record that uncertainty. Honest uncertainty produces a more responsible interpretation than a false exact minute.

八字真太阳时:为什么出生地点和钟表时间可能重要

许多八字计算器询问出生地,并不只是为了查时区。传统排盘可能会比较钟表时间与当地太阳时。差异可能来自同一时区内的经度位置、历史夏令时记录和均时差。

这种差异在接近传统双时辰边界时最重要。如果校正把记录时间从一个时支移到另一个时支,时柱就可能改变;远离边界时,相同校正也可能完全不改变时柱。透明的计算器应显示校正是否改变了日期或时支,而不是暗示每个结果都同样敏感。

八字不存在唯一通行的全球规则。有些实践者使用标准当地时间,有些使用真太阳时校正,还有些对子初换日采用不同约定。差异提醒我们保持谦逊,而不是恐慌。比较不同网站的命盘时,先比较它们的计算政策,再判断结果为何不同。

较好的输入方式是:填写记录上的出生地点、出生地当地钟表时间和正确的历史日期。除非工具明确要求,否则不要自行换算 UTC。若家人只记得“大约中午”或“深夜”,请保留这种不确定性。诚实的不确定性,比虚构精确到分钟的资料更负责任。
